HDFC AMC announces temporary suspension of subscriptions in Schemes
Mar-28-2024

HDFC Asset Management Company (AMC) has announced addendum to the Scheme Information Document (SID) / Key Information Memorandum (KIM) of HDFC Developed World Indexes Fund of Funds.

HDFC Mutual Fund has informed that, as per SEBI communication dated March 19, 2024, in order to avoid breach of mutual fund industry-wide limits for overseas Exchange Traded Funds (‘ETFs’), mutual funds in India have been advised to stop subscriptions in Schemes intending to invest in overseas ETFs. Accordingly, as per AMFI Advisory dated March 20, 2024, the following transactions under the Scheme shall stand suspended until further notice:

1. Subscriptions [including by way of lumpsum, Switch-ins], shall not be accepted in HDFC Developed World Indexes Fund of Funds (‘the Scheme’) with effect from March 28, 2024 after cut-off timing i.e. 3.00 pm.

2. New Registrations of Systematic Investment Plan (SIP) / Systematic Transfer Plan (STP) / Transfer of IDCW Plan (TIP), etc. shall not be accepted in the Scheme with effect from April 1, 2024. 

3. Existing installments of Systematic Transactions such as SIP/ STP/ TIP etc. into the Scheme shall be paused with effect from April 1, 2024.

4. Redemptions, Switch-out, Registration of fresh Systematic Withdrawal Plan (SWAP), Existing instalments of SWAP, and STP-out from the Scheme, intra sc shall continue to be processed. 

5. Intra-Scheme switches (viz. Regular Plan to Direct Plan and vice versa) and Intra-Plan switches (viz. Growth Option to IDCW Option and vice versa) shall continue to be accepted.
